Summary
A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in WinFtp Server 2.0.2. The affected element is an unknown function. Performing a manipulation results in denial of service. This vulnerability was named CVE-2006-6673. In addition, an exploit is available.
Details
A vulnerability was found in WinFtp Server 2.0.2 (File Transfer Software). It has been classified as problematic. This affects some unknown processing.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. This is going to have an impact on availability. The summary by CVE is:
WinFtp Server 2.0.2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via long (1) PASV, (2) LIST, (3) USER, (4) PORT, and possibly other commands.
The weakness was presented 12/20/2006 (Website). It is possible to read the advisory at vupen.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2006-6673 since 12/20/2006.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available.
The exploit is shared for download at exploit-db.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
